Output 177094b851279854162d59847a412abd5b4c243b9760b3bcc0e99f34fb574e83:0

value
63200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abcb2aa6b5bfa9348af62046da512c29ce4eb30 OP_EQUAL
address
3BRPbqbMqbXSy2xwupZLjH8TzeEBeL226u
transaction
177094b851279854162d59847a412abd5b4c243b9760b3bcc0e99f34fb574e83
confirmations
262920
spent
true